Web14 Apr 2024 · The Indian Contract Act, of 1872 , defines a contract as an agreement that is enforceable under the law. Section 2(h) of the Act states that for an agreement to be considered a contract, it must meet certain legal requirements. The age of the majority is eighteen. Any agreement entered into with a minor is void ab initio (void from beginning). highlight whole row if condition is metWeb1 Apr 2024 · The term “contract” is defined in Section 2 (h) of the Indian Contract Act, 1872, as follows: “An agreement enforceable by law is a contract.”.
